Little Asghar * is the seventh child of Dhani Bux and Amina Bibi. They reside in a small coastal village along the Arabian sea in Sindh Pakistan. After an unseasonably heavy rainfall this September, Asghar fell ill with cough and high fever. As days went by, he started experiencing shortness of breath as well. Dhani Bux is a poor fisherman who rarely has money left over from basic necessities to take care of a sick child. When his wife insisted, he took Asghar to see a local doctor but his condition did not improve, it did not help matters that he did not have the money to give the doctor‘s fee as well as buy medicines for the child.
A neighbor told him about SHINE Humanity’s Khuti Khun Mobile clinic. He was happy to hear that a doctor visits his area two times a week and that the clinic gives free medicines for 3 days. The coming Wednesday, both parents took Asghar to see the doctor. The child was diagnosed with a chest infection/asthma and was nebulized immediately. He was given oral medications and advised a followup visit next week.
Within 3 days Asghar was feeling much better and happy to be playing with his siblings.
SHINE Humanity has been providing quality primary health care to an underserved population for four years now. Till now we have treated more than a quarter of a million patients,overwhelmingly women and children..
